  1. Há 3 dias · She died, while still an infant, in January 1448–9, when the estates passed to her aunt Anne, wife of Richard Neville, Earl of Salisbury and Warwick. After his death at the battle of Barnet in 1471 the Warwick estates were settled on his elder daughter Isabel, wife of George, Duke of Clarence, the rights of his widow Anne being ignored.

Há 4 dias · Guy, Earl of Warwick, died in 1315 seised of ⅓ knight's fee here held by William son of Nicholas de Warwick, who was returned as being lord of the vill of Fulbrook in the following year. (fn. 64) But by 1324 it had passed to John de Hastings, Lord Bergavenny, who died in that year holding it of the Earl of Warwick, by the service of a knight's fee.
